Africa-Press – Sierra-Leone. The Parliament of Sierra Leone has on Friday 11/11/2022, enacted into law, with some amendments the bill entitled,” The Constitution of Sierra Leone (Amendment) Act, 2022 for the good governance of Sierra Leone.

The Bill is being an Act to amend the Constitution of Sierra Leone, 1991 (Act No. 6 of 1991) to rename the “Political Parties Registration Commission as the ” Political Parties Regulation Commission”, to replace the administrator and Registrar General with Executive Secretary as Secretary to the Commission and to provide for other related matters.

The Constitutional amendment sailed through the Two-Third Majority, by Members of Parliament and it was passed into law.The Bill was piloted by the Attorney General and Minister of Justice, Mohamed Lamin Tarawally.
